Drag on a Micropolar Flow Past a Cylinder Specifying Uniform Velocity away from the Boundaries

Gopinatha K.R | Jayalakshmamma D. V | D.V. Chandrashekhar


Abstract: A study of the effect of drag force on an micropolar flow past a cylinder specifying uniform velocity away from the boundaries. We find a similarity solution, assuming the fluid outside the cylinder and satisfies the Eringen’s micro polar equations and applying no slip condition at the cylinder of the surface. An appearance for drag force is obtained. It is found that the increase in the coupling parameter with fixed coupling stress parameter is to increase drag. Further a reversed behavior is noticed that the drag is decreases and the same is represented graphically


Keywords: micropolar flow, coupling stress parameter, Drag, Eringen’s micropolar equations
